backport SVN commit 847417 by kloecker:

Center the current message when selecting multiple messages with Shift+Left/Right. This is consistent with the behavior of most other actions (like going to next/previous [unread] message).


svn path=/branches/KDE/4.1/kdepim/; revision=847622
wilder-work
Allen Winter 18 years ago
parent 65d71c4013
commit ebffec3bf4
  1. 4
      kmheaders.cpp

@ -1865,7 +1865,7 @@ void KMHeaders::selectNextMessage()
/* test to see if we need to unselect messages on back track */
(below->isSelected() ? setSelected(lvi, false) : setSelected(below, true));
setCurrentItem(below);
makeHeaderVisible();
ensureCurrentItemVisible();
setFolderInfoStatus();
}
}
@ -1904,7 +1904,7 @@ void KMHeaders::selectPrevMessage()
/* test to see if we need to unselect messages on back track */
(above->isSelected() ? setSelected(lvi, false) : setSelected(above, true));
setCurrentItem(above);
makeHeaderVisible();
ensureCurrentItemVisible();
setFolderInfoStatus();
}
}

Loading…
Cancel
Save